Rising AI demand lifts Cisco to another earnings and revenue beat – and a 20% stock pop.
Cisco Systems Inc. reported third-quarter earnings with adjusted earnings per share of $1.06, slightly beating Wall Street expectations of $1.04; revenue of $15.84 billion, up 12% year-over-year, exceeding the expected $15.56 billion. Net profit reached $3.37 billion, a significant increase. The company's stock surged 20% in after-hours trading. Cisco also announced a new round of layoffs, affecting fewer than 4,000 positions, or less than 5% of its workforce, with an estimated $1 billion in restructuring costs to optimize cost structure and focus on AI opportunities. CEO Chuck Robbins revealed that the company has secured $5.3 billion in AI infrastructure orders from hyperscale cloud providers this year, with a full-year projection of over $9 billion, and raised its AI market revenue target to $4 billion. The company's networking business revenue surged 25% to $8.82 billion, becoming the main growth engine. Despite flat security and collaboration businesses, Cisco has strongly rebounded thanks to AI infrastructure demand, with its stock up over 32% year-to-date, far outperforming the Nasdaq index. Meanwhile, Cisco completed two acquisitions: Israeli cybersecurity company Astrix Security Ltd. for nearly $300 million, and AI-native observability startup Galileo Technologies Inc., aiming to strengthen its 'agentic' security products. The earnings highlight Cisco's regained competitiveness in the AI wave, with analysts saying it has moved past its previous growth struggles.

Cerebras prices its shares at $185 ahead of the biggest tech IPO in years, raising $5.5 billion.
AI chip maker Cerebras Systems Inc. has officially set its IPO price at $185 per share, above the expected range of $150 to $160, raising at least $5.5 billion, making it a highly anticipated IPO this year. The company will go public today under the ticker CBRS, with a fully diluted market cap of $56.4 billion. Founded in 2016 and headquartered in Silicon Valley, Cerebras's flagship WSE-3 chip is roughly the size of a dinner plate, featuring 44GB of SRAM memory and 900,000 cores, optimized for AI inference and significantly outperforming Nvidia's Blackwell B200 GPU. Over the past year, shares of Intel (INTC), AMD, and Micron (MU) have surged over 80%, as the semiconductor industry booms due to the AI craze. Cerebras was once heavily reliant on a single customer, G42, which accounted for 80% of sales, but after a review by the U.S. Committee on Foreign Investment in the United States, it gained approval and diversified revenue by launching cloud services. By 2025, G42's share dropped to 24%, while another UAE customer, MBZUAI, accounted for 62%. Recently, the company signed a $20 billion agreement with OpenAI to provide computing capacity, and AWS will also integrate its chips into the Bedrock service. Investors are bullish on its potential as an alternative to Nvidia for inference, and this high-priced IPO signals intensifying innovation and competition in the AI chip space, which could drive down industry costs.

Graphon reels in $8.3 million for its persistent relational memory platform.
AI startup Graphon Inc. today announced its launch and the completion of an $8.3 million seed funding round led by Novera Ventures, with participation from the venture arms of Perplexity AI Inc., Samsung Electronics Co., and Hitachi Ltd. The company has developed an innovative software platform aimed at solving the context window limitations of large language models (LLMs). Currently, the most advanced LLMs have a context window of only 1 million tokens, making it difficult to process ultra-large datasets. Traditional RAG (retrieval-augmented generation) tools can extract key records but struggle to identify relationships between them, such as attack patterns in cybersecurity data. The Graphon platform can analyze datasets of over a million tokens, using a small AI model with about 200 million parameters and a graph structure to identify key patterns and store them in persistent relational memory, allowing LLMs to bypass context limits and efficiently extract patterns. The technology also uses graphon functions to scan interconnected records in graph datasets. Graphon founder and CEO Arbaaz Khan emphasized that the world is built on relationships, not tokens, and this technology improves the accuracy and practicality of foundation models in enterprise applications. Graphon is one of several venture-backed startups; last week, Subquadratic Inc. raised $29 million for a Transformer architecture that can handle 14 million tokens more efficiently, while Standard Intelligence Inc. uses masked compression to remove irrelevant data, enhancing LLM processing capabilities.

Anthropic launches Claude for Small Business with new automation workflows.
Anthropic PBC today launched Claude for Small Business, a service designed for small business owners to expand adoption of its chatbot Claude among entrepreneurs. This is the fifth market-specific version launched since early 2025, following products for life science researchers, schools, lawyers, and financial professionals. Claude for Small Business is built on Claude Cowork, released in January this year, which supports multi-step cross-application task execution and scheduled repetition. New third-party application connectors include Intuit QuickBooks, PayPal, HubSpot, Canva, DocuSign, Google Workspace, and Microsoft 365, along with 15 new skills and plugins. These preset skills and plugins focus primarily on accounting automation, such as account reconciliation, comparing QuickBooks general ledger data with PayPal payment logs to verify accuracy. Users can also create custom workflows, for example, a retailer combining QuickBooks revenue data with HubSpot ad metrics to generate a recurring Slack report, or automatically launching a marketing campaign when sales slow down. Anthropic's other vertical products also integrate application connectors, such as the financial analysis version accessing S&P data sources. On the same day, the company updated its Agent SDK, providing third-party AI agents with access to Claude models and offering paid users monthly credits of $20 to $200, starting June 15. This move further strengthens Claude's application in enterprise automation.

Anthropic announces ‘programmatic credit pool’ as agentic tool use rises
Anthropic PBC announced a dedicated 'programmatic credit pool' for Claude large language model users. Starting June 15, all paid subscription tiers will receive automatic monthly credits to support agentic applications for agentic tools. This move aims to address the rapid adoption of agent AI in coding and personal use while separating daily interaction subscriptions from high-computation automated agent usage. Previously, Anthropic cut off subscription accounts' access to third-party agent frameworks due to surging demand from open-source projects like OpenClaw, shifting to credit-based API billing, which raised user costs. The new credit pool allows users to connect third-party agent tools to Claude as a 'brain.' Once credits are exhausted, users can pay extra to continue 'interactive' use, but credits do not roll over, sparking dissatisfaction among some users who see it as a downgrade from existing subscriptions. Similar adjustments are spreading across the industry: GitHub will shift Copilot to AI credit billing starting June 1, and infrastructure providers like Fireworks AI and Together Computer have adopted token-based serverless inference models. Anthropic's move highlights the high computational consumption of agent AI, and enterprise-grade production agents may shift to budget-controlled metered environments, marking a shift toward refined AI pricing models.

Figma's stock rises as first-quarter revenue jumps 46% due to AI monetization momentum.
Figma Inc. shares rose over 12% in after-hours trading after its fiscal first-quarter 2026 results beat expectations and the company raised its full-year guidance. The company reported adjusted earnings per share of $0.10 and revenue of $333.4 million, up 233% and 46% year-over-year respectively, both exceeding analyst estimates of $0.06 and $316 million. Revenue growth accelerated for the second consecutive quarter, rising from 40% in the prior quarter to 46%. Despite reporting a net loss of $142.4 million, primarily due to $169 million in stock-based compensation, customer growth was strong: customers with annual recurring revenue over $10,000 reached 15,200, up 37%; those over $100,000 reached 1,525, up 48%; total paid customers were approximately 690,000, up 54%. Net dollar retention rate hit 139%, a two-year high. Adoption of Figma's AI products continued to climb, with 60% of paid customers spending over $100,000 using the natural language design tool Figma Make weekly, up from over 50% last quarter. New Pro team conversion rates grew over 150% year-over-year. Results from an AI credit limit test implemented on March 18 were positive, with over 75% of organization and enterprise users continuing to use the feature and 95% remaining active. Pro teams purchasing AI add-ons had three times the ARR of those that did not. Weekly active users of the Model Context Protocol server grew five times quarter-over-quarter, and high-value customers using the server grew 70% faster overall. Business highlights included the Code to Canvas integration with tools like Claude Code, Codex, Cursor, VS Code, and Warp, as well as new MCP features and the Figma Weave timeline editor. Second-quarter revenue guidance was set at $348 million to $350 million, with full-year guidance raised to $1.422 billion to $1.428 billion, well above expectations.

OpenAI says hackers stole some data after latest code security issue
Earlier this week, hackers hijacked multiple open-source projects to push malicious updates to software used by dozens of companies, marking the latest supply chain attack targeting software developers. On Wednesday, OpenAI confirmed that two employees' devices were affected by an attack on the TanStack open-source library, which is used for developing web applications. After an investigation, OpenAI said it found no evidence of user data leaks, damage to production systems or intellectual property, or software tampering. TanStack disclosed on Monday that hackers released 84 malicious versions in six minutes, designed to steal credentials and self-propagate; researchers detected the attack within 20 minutes. OpenAI noted that only limited internal source code repository credentials were stolen, and the affected repositories contained digital certificates. The company has rotated the certificates, and macOS users need to update their applications. OpenAI emphasized that existing software installations are not at risk. The attackers' identity is unknown; similar past incidents have involved TeamPCP, North Korean hackers hijacking Axios, and Chinese hackers targeting Daemon Tools. This strategy of spreading malware through disguised updates in open-source projects can efficiently impact many targets, highlighting supply chain security vulnerabilities. Companies like OpenAI need to strengthen open-source dependency reviews and security measures.

OpenAI is reportedly preparing legal action against Apple; it wouldn’t be the first partner to feel burned
According to Bloomberg, OpenAI is dissatisfied with the integration of ChatGPT into Apple products and is actively considering legal action against Apple. The partnership, announced at Apple's Worldwide Developers Conference in June 2024, integrated ChatGPT into Siri and iPhone visual intelligence features. OpenAI had expected billions of dollars in subscription revenue and exposure on the world's largest mobile ecosystem. However, the integration features are deeply buried and hard to find, and actual revenue has fallen far short of expectations. OpenAI has hired an external law firm to evaluate options and may issue a formal notice of breach, but could delay litigation until after resolving its lawsuit with Elon Musk. Apple, meanwhile, is unhappy with OpenAI's privacy standards and its forays into hardware, such as a project led by former design chief Jony Ive. This incident highlights the complexity of Apple as a partner, which has historically clashed with Google (over Maps removal), Adobe (over Flash support), Spotify (over App Store monopoly fines), and others. Despite this, Apple recently signed a multi-year deal with Google to pay about $1 billion annually to use the Gemini model to support Apple Intelligence. OpenAI also faces a lawsuit from Musk and tensions with its biggest backer, Microsoft, as it seeks independence to advance its IPO plans. This partnership dispute could reshape the landscape of AI partnerships.

Centrality is not vitality
When analyzing the dependency graph of open source ecosystems, PageRank is often used as a metric for "importance" or "centrality," even though its assumptions do not apply to dependency graphs. Research shows that PageRank values mainly reflect a node's position in the graph rather than the actual importance or maintenance status of the package; about 12% of the most depended-upon packages are confirmed dead, and another 19% are untested. This suggests that centrality rankings in dependency graphs may not accurately reflect package activity and risk.

Catch Flakes On Main
"Flaky tests" are tests that occasionally fail over thousands of runs, which may stem from real bugs or infrastructure instability. As test suites grow in size and complexity, more continuous integration (CI) runs experience false failures, leading to decreased productivity. By aggregating all failed tests into a single list, teams can more effectively identify and prioritize the root causes of instability.
